Kenya, Day 1
Early wake, though woke many times to the sounds of barking dogs. Felt better at first, but after breakfast slowly went downhill. Perhaps the milk or the juice? Short flight to Nairobi, but with this stomach, surely better than the 12 hour busride. Had emailed for a room reservation the night before, it went through. I've arranged for a safari starting tomorrow - the info desks at the airport are there to sell us stuff. Unsure of the details of the safari, was through a feverish haze, but i think it sounded good.
Walked around Nairobi a bit. Maybe not the best to do in this condition, supposed to be a bit dangerous, nicknamed "Nairobbery". Can it be that much worse than any other 3rd world city?
First impression: Nairobi is to Kampala as Bangkok is to Phnom Pehn.
